Otley The Whartons Primary School is performing well and continues to be regarded as a good school by the community it serves. The positive atmosphere at the school is complemented by high expectations and a strong focus on personal development, with pupils actively engaging in a variety of enrichment activities. The leadership team has successfully prioritized reading and implemented effective teaching strategies, which have resulted in most pupils achieving well in their studies. However, the school acknowledges the need to improve its support for pupils with special educational needs and/or disabilities (SEND) by clearly defining the essential knowledge they should acquire throughout the curriculum. Although the school displays many strengths in its academic and personal development offerings, there are concerns about communication with parents and some inconsistencies in implementing changes within the school. The dedication of staff and the support available for both staff and students contribute significantly to the school's overall atmosphere, but further work is necessary to ensure all families feel adequately informed and engaged.

Progress Scores
A progress score is a way to measure how well a student progressed in comparison to other students of a similar starting ability. A score of zero means would mean that a student made the same progress as others that had a similar starting a ability. A positive score would mean that the student made more progress than other students of similar starting ability. The scores below are for the whole school so is the average progress score across all students.
